Sorry for getting back so late, but they were amazing. Their guitarists were 100% on and the dual solos were awesome. Since it was a small venue you could literally touch them while they were playing. I was amazed at how fast the drummer was. He was playing standard 4/4 beats just like twice as fast as most other drummers. The bassist just ran around and looked badass while the singer was out of control. It was an awesome show and I got the best sweaty hi-five ever.
